Udostępnij za pomocą


Szybki start: wdrażanie projektu Java na platformie Azure przy użyciu modernizacji aplikacji GitHub Copilot

W tym przewodniku Szybki start wdrożysz projekt Java na platformie Azure przy użyciu modernizacji aplikacji GitHub Copilot.

W przypadku programowania kodu deweloperzy często muszą wdrażać swój projekt w środowisku chmury na potrzeby testowania. Nasze narzędzia pomagają wdrożyć zmigrowany projekt na platformę Azure i naprawić wszelkie błędy wdrażania w procesie.

Wymagania wstępne

Uwaga / Notatka

Jeśli używasz narzędzia Gradle, obsługiwana jest tylko wersja wrappera Gradle 5 lub nowsza. Język specyficzny dla domeny Kotlin (DSL) nie jest obsługiwany.

Funkcja My Tasks nie jest jeszcze obsługiwana w środowisku IntelliJ IDEA.

Wdrażanie projektu

Aby rozpocząć proces wdrażania, wykonaj następujące kroki:

  1. W programie Visual Studio Code otwórz zmigrowany projekt.

  2. Na pasku bocznym Działanie otwórz okienko rozszerzenia modernizacji aplikacji GitHub Copilot .

  3. W sekcji Zadania otwórz Java, a następnie otwórz Zadania wdrażania i wybierz Wdróż w istniejącej infrastrukturze Azure lub aprowizuj infrastrukturę i wdróż na platformie Azure.

    Zrzut ekranu programu Visual Studio Code przedstawiający zadanie Aprowizuj infrastrukturę i Wdróż na platformie Azure z wyróżnionym przyciskiem Uruchom zadanie.

  4. Jeśli wybierzesz pozycję Wdróż w istniejącej infrastrukturze platformy Azure, Copilot poprosi Cię o istniejącą grupę zasobów podczas procesu. Analizuje grupę zasobów i wdraża je w odpowiednich zasobach.

  5. Jeśli wybierzesz pozycję Aprowizuj infrastrukturę i wdróż na platformie Azure, Copilot konfiguruje nowe zasoby platformy Azure i rozmieszcza Twój projekt.

  6. Po wybraniu zadania zostanie automatycznie otwarte okno czatu copilot z trybem agenta.

  7. Wybierz pozycję Kontynuuj wielokrotnie, aby potwierdzić kolejną akcję narzędzia w oknie czatu Copilot. Agent Copilot używa różnych narzędzi do ułatwienia wdrażania na platformie Azure. Użycie każdego narzędzia wymaga potwierdzenia, wybierając pozycję Kontynuuj. Przekaż copilot niezbędne informacje, takie jak subskrypcja i grupa zasobów, gdy zostanie wyświetlony monit.

  8. Rozwiązanie Copilot zwykle wykonuje następujące kroki, aby wdrożyć projekt:

    • Copilot generuje plik markdown planu wdrożenia z celem wdrożenia, informacjami o projekcie, architekturą zasobów platformy Azure, zasobami platformy Azure i krokami wykonywania.
    • Copilot wykonuje kroki opisane w tym pliku.
    • Copilot naprawia błędy wdrażania.
    • Copilot generuje plik podsumowania wyjaśniający wyniki wdrożenia.

Uwaga / Notatka

Zalecamy używanie modeli Claude Sonnet 4 lub nowszych w celu uzyskania najlepszych wyników.

Aby Copilot mógł skorygować błędy wdrażania, może to zająć kilka iteracji.

Zobacz także

Aby dowiedzieć się więcej o modernizacji aplikacji GitHub Copilot, zobacz dokumentację modernizacji aplikacji GitHub Copilot.